San Juan Swimming Pool Closes in February Due to Reconstruction Project

The San Juan Natatorium will temporarily close its pool facilities while renovations are carried out as part of Phase 3 of the Dr. Hernán Padilla Central Park rehabilitation project. The work aims to modernize and enhance one of the city's most important sports and recreational spaces.
The works, at a cost of nearly $11.7 million, will keep the sports center closed for 12 months, Mayor Miguel Romero indicated.
